...I caved. I bought a little yellow dude that turns into a car. And it's not Bumblebee. He's got team mates he combines with, one of whom I got with him! And the better version of that Deluxe Optimus toy. And then I found a Not-Optimus worth getting...
FansProject Causality CA-09 Car Crash
FansProject Causality CA-11 Down Force
Generations 30th Megatron
Generations 30th Orion Pax
United UN-22 Laser Optimus Prime
The Causality cars are pretty cool looking in both modes. Pose able, too. Car Crash has some parts that don't quite like cooperating in a buttery smooth manner...going into car mode in particular. And since T-Bone has a very similar transformation and body, I suspect the same will hold true for him once I can get him. Down Force could have used something to lock the head up in robot mode. It won't fall back down on its own, but there's nothing to resist being pushed down when trying to turn the head. Knees are limited too, but at least they cut a divot out of the back of the thigh to free it up a bit. Dinkiest gun pieces ever, thus this guy must never be played with in places where tiny pieces could get lost FOREVER. United Laser Optimus... Oh man is this figure good. Suck it, Wreck-Gar and Perceptor, this guy is the best from your wave in the Reveal the Shield line. (Jazz is still the best of the Deluxe figures in that line) And the United version fixes my biggest gripe with the RtS version in that the cab is black, not dark blue when everything around it is black. AWESOME light piping effects, and I don't mean his eyes. Megatron is the IDW stealth bomber design fans have been asking for since it debuted in the previous Ongoing series. Granted, most fans were likely hoping for a Voyager at the least, and by the time this toy came out he's long since dropped this body like yesterday's junk, but at least we got it. And WOW is this thing cool. Orion Pax is pretty devious. He's an Optimus Prime toy, and yet technically he isn't. I like the weapons well enough, and I like how different Orion's transformation is from the typical Optimus Prime transformation. The panel behind his head is a little distracting, but overall I'm happy with the first new mold Orion Pax toy ever. (the ehobby Orion Pax is a repaint of Kup)
Sadly, the international versions of the Generations 30th Deluxe figures do not include the Spotlight comics for the toys. Instead they all have a huge sticker of Orion Pax's comic cover picture stuck onto the cardback above the bubble. Yay. (not like the international version of Metroplex is all that worth it...maybe if the rumors of him showing up at CostCo for like $80 later this year prove true) At least Orion's insert for the international versions doesn't have MEGATRON plastered in front of his pic on the side... Oops. Hopefully I can score Trailcutter/Trailbreaker later. Not sure if I want Bumblebee or if I want to hold off for Goldfire. Also gotta hit up Chapters and see if I can obtain ANY of these Spotlight comics. I hear Megatron's is pretty cool, and I am interested in Orion's antics with Alpha Trion.
